Figure 6.

Neonatal myelinating cells dedifferentiate slowly in the absence of c-Jun. (A and B) Comparison of P0 expression in control cells from c-Junfl/fl/CRE(cJun con) mice and cells without c-Jun from c-Junfl/fl/CRE+ (cJun null) mice prepared at P5 and cultured in DM containing 20 ng/ml NRG-1 for 4 d. (A) Cells with high myelination-related levels of P0 have largely disappeared from control cultures. (B) c-Jun–null cultures retain numerous cells with high P0, two of which are illustrated. (C–F) Similar delay in the loss of periaxin in cells prepared at P2 from nerves of cJun–null mice cultured for 2 d (see Materials and methods). (C and D) Control cultures are c-Jun positive and periaxin has largely disappeared. (E and F) c-Jun–null cultures are c-Jun negative and retain a large number of strongly periaxin-positive cells. (G and H) Similar experiments with cells from JunAA mice. These cells lose periaxin expression at the same rate as control cells, indicating that the major N-terminal phosphorylation sites of c-Jun are not needed for suppression of periaxin. Bar, 15 μm. (I) Quantification of the results illustrated in C–H. The graph shows the number of periaxin-positive cells (relative to the number 3 h after plating) in c-Jun control, c-Jun–null and JunAA cells after 2, 4, and 6 d in DM ± 20 ng/ml NRG-1. (J) mRNA for myelin genes disappears only slowly from c-Jun–null cells. Schwann cells purified from control, c-Jun–null, and JunAA P3 mice were plated for 48 h in DM before RNA was extracted and levels of myelin markers were analyzed by quantitative PCR. Relative expression levels of c-Jun, MBP, periaxin, and P0 (MPZ) were obtained by normalizing samples to GAPDH. The data were then expressed as a percentage of the maximum (1) for each of the four genes. The difference in MBP, P0, and periaxin mRNA levels between c-Jun control and null mice was significant (P < 0.01). The same applies to the differences between JunAA and null mice. The dataset for each gene was analyzed by one-way ANOVA and Tukey's Multiple Comparison test where appropriate (using GraphPad Prism Software). Error bars show one standard deviation of the mean. AU, arbitrary units.
